Subject: [PATCH 1/6] PCI: Add PCI_EXP_SLTCTL_ASPL_DISABLE macro
Date: Tue, 22 Feb 2022 17:31:53 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20220222163158.1666-2-pali@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20220222163158.1666-1-pali@kernel.org>
Add macro defining Auto Slot Power Limit Disable bit in Slot Control
Register.
Signed-off-by: Pali Rohár <pali@kernel.org>
Signed-off-by: Marek Behún <kabel@kernel.org>
---
include/uapi/linux/pci_regs.h | 1 +
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
diff --git a/include/uapi/linux/pci_regs.h b/include/uapi/linux/pci_regs.h
index bee1a9ed6e66..108f8523fa04 100644
--- a/include/uapi/linux/pci_regs.h
+++ b/include/uapi/linux/pci_regs.h
@@ -616,6 +616,7 @@
#define PCI_EXP_SLTCTL_PWR_OFF 0x0400 /* Power Off */
#define PCI_EXP_SLTCTL_EIC 0x0800 /* Electromechanical Interlock Control */
#define PCI_EXP_SLTCTL_DLLSCE 0x1000 /* Data Link Layer State Changed Enable */
+#define PCI_EXP_SLTCTL_ASPL_DISABLE 0x2000 /* Auto Slot Power Limit Disable */
#define PCI_EXP_SLTCTL_IBPD_DISABLE 0x4000 /* In-band PD disable */
#define PCI_EXP_SLTSTA 0x1a /* Slot Status */
#define PCI_EXP_SLTSTA_ABP 0x0001 /* Attention Button Pressed */
